1.Do your homework
Find subtle ways to demonstrate
your knowledge of the
organization. Weave in some
dialogue that reflects their
history, their products, their
messaging, etc. You’ve got a
limited amount of space to let
the reader know you’re their guy
(or girl). Remember, you want
to be perceived as a natural fit
and someone who ―gets‖ the
company.

2.Writer unique cover letter
Always customize your cover letter
for the position you are applying to.
Sending the same letter to each
position will not only make you
sound generic, but it will also leave
room for costly mistakes like
having the wrong company name.

3.First Paragraph and last line
Don't waffle in your first
paragraph, make the reason
you're writing clear and sell
yourself; writing what makes
you better than others straight
off. Finish with a call to
action, request they contact
you for a meeting or
interview and let them know
you will be in touch to
discuss.

4.Provide quality evidence of your qualities
Pick out the top 3 or 5 (max)
qualities the employer is
seeking in their advert or job
specification if there is one.
These should be qualities that
you have already covered in
your CV.
And they should be the 3 to 5
things that you refer to - not
explain - briefly in your
covering letter. Provide
concrete examples and solid
numbers wherever you can.

5.Don't repeat your résumé
While your cover letter should
reference material from your
résumé, it shouldn't simply be a
word-for-word repeat. Use the
cover letter to expand where
necessary and discuss your listed
experiences from a different angle.
Craft the letter to acknowledge the
requirements of the role and
culture of the organization, while
highlighting the skills and
experiences that align with the job
description.

6.Emphasize your personal value
Hiring managers are looking for people who
can help them solve problems. Drawing on the
research you did earlier, show that you know
what the company does and some of the
challenges it faces. These don’t need to be
specific but you might mention a trend that’s
affected the industry. For example, you might
write, ―A lot of healthcare companies are
grappling with how the changing laws will
affect their ability to provide high-quality
care.‖ Then talk about how your experience
has equipped you to meet those needs;
perhaps explain how you solved a similar
problem in the past or share a relevant
accomplishment.

7.Avoid spelling and grammar mistakes.
Nothing says loser like a cover
letter filled with spelling and/or
grammatical errors.
What do such mistakes convey
to a potential employer? They
suggest that you do sloppy
work, that you don’t pay much
attention to detail, that you
don’t care enough to do a good
job, that you’re uneducated, or
that you’re not very bright.

8.Relevant and brief
A well written letter
should draw the recruiter's
eye to relevant experience
on your CV. It is a,
admittedly brief, space in
which you draw a positive
pen-picture of you in the
mind of the employer.
Ensure it is never more
than a page long.

10.Contact details
Where ever possible send
your letter and CV to a
named individual,
particularly if it is more of
an enquiry than a specific
role application. Research
using websites, ask friends
and colleagues if they know
of anyone or ring through to
reception and get yourself a
name and job title. It will
look a lot better than sir/
madam.

11.Apply locally.
If you’re applying for work far from
where you live, you’d better explain
why in your cover letter. And your
explanation should sound plausible.
Otherwise the employer may wonder:
Why is this person looking for work so
far from home? Are they unable to find
work locally? They must not be very
good.
